A Look Back At Rose Hanbury's Modeling Career Before Royal Fame

Rose Hanbury wears many hats these days, including that of wife, mother of three, a patron of East Anglia’s Children’s Hospices, and meticulous caretaker of Houghton Hall, the historical estate she and hubby David Rocksavage, 7th Marquess of Cholmondeley inherited. “It’s a case of constantly keeping an eye on things, making sure you get expert advice and help in the conservation [of the interiors and architecture]. We take great pride and care in doing so,” Hanbury told The English Home. 

No doubt, Hanbury’s current life of sophisticated domesticity is in stark contrast to her younger years working as a fashion model. The story goes that Hanbury landed a modeling contract with Storm Management at 23 years old. As you may recall, supermodel Kate Moss also signed with the same British modeling agency. So yeah, it’s a pretty big deal. 

While Hanbury has remained relatively mum about that time in her life, she does provide glimpses every now and then by way of Houghton Hall’s official Instagram account. “A very old photo that re-emerged on my phone today, from a shoot with @poplinlondon. I’m sitting in a room at Houghton which I particularly love because of all the rich colours and old velvet curtains,” the marchioness recalled in a nostalgic post on February 28, 2022.
